L’installation des outils de la suite Elastic est simplifiée depuis plusieurs versions et la disponibilité de paquets pour les distributions principales, et même de dépôts, simplifiants les mises à jour.
Les instructions détaillées ci-dessous permettent d’installer Kibana (dashboard), Elasticsearch (stockage), ainsi que Metricbeat (monitoring système) afin de visualiser rapidement des premières données.
Une fois Docker et docker-composer
installés, nous vous proposons d’utiliser nos configurations :
git clone https://github.com/Vizually/Docker vizually-docker
cd vizually-docker/kibana/6.3
docker-compose up
Vous pouvez désormais accéder aux services via les URLs suivantes:
Rendez-vous maintenant dans la section Dashboard, où vous verrez apparaître les dashboards Metricbeat créés automatiquement.
# Détection du mode à utiliser selon l'utilisateur courant
SUDO=$(test `id -u` -eq 0 || echo sudo)
# Installation de la clé du dépôt Elastic
wget -qO - https://artifacts.elastic.co/GPG-KEY-elasticsearch | $SUDO apt-key add -
# Installation des paquets nécessaires
$SUDO apt-get install apt-transport-https
# Installation de Java (s'il n'est pas déjà installé, 'java -version' pour vérifier)
$SUDO apt-get install default-jre-headless
# Ajout du dépôt Elastic aux sources
echo 'deb https://artifacts.elastic.co/packages/6.x/apt stable main' | $SUDO tee -a /etc/apt/sources.list.d/elastic-6.x.list
$SUDO apt-get update
# Installation des applications depuis le dépôt Elastic
$SUDO apt-get install elasticsearch kibana metricbeat
Modifiez le fichier de configuration /etc/metricbeat/metricbeat.yml
afin de créer automatiquement les dashboards :
# ...
setup.dashboards.enabled: true
# ...
Puis activez et lancez les services :
$SUDO systemctl enable elasticsearch
$SUDO systemctl enable kibana
$SUDO systemctl enable metricbeat
$SUDO systemctl start elasticsearch
$SUDO systemctl start kibana
$SUDO systemctl start metricbeat
Rendez-vous sur votre dashboard Kibana (IP ou hostname de votre machine, port 5601, par exemple http://1.2.3.4:5601/), section Dashboard, où vous verrez apparaître les dashboards Metricbeat.
Vous souhaitez une démonstration du potentiel de l’outil Vizually, des conseils, de l’accompagnement ou une mise en place pour votre entreprise ?
Nous serons ravis de pouvoir échanger avec vous sur vos projets, contactez-nous.